About the role

Responsibilities

  • Provide comprehensive diagnostic, preventive, and corrective maintenance for production facilities
  • Conduct routine inspections to proactively identify and address potential issues
  • Complete electromechanical component repair and replacement
  • Diagnose and resolve complex electromechanical problems promptly
  • Participate in safety audits and investigations
  • Collaborate with maintenance planners, supervisors, and managers on scheduling
  • Manage equipment maintenance across mechanical, electrical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and instrumentation systems
  • Maintain daily production records, KPIs, and downtime information
  • Troubleshoot electrical control systems, including motors and PLCs

Requirements

  • High school Diploma or Equivalent
  • Extensive technical expertise in troubleshooting and diagnostics
  • Hands-on experience with complex mechanical systems
  • Proficiency in reading mechanical and electrical drawings
  • Experience with AC/DC electrical systems, motion control, pneumatics, and hydraulics
  • Familiarity with 480 VAC and lower voltages
  • Understanding of NEC codes and NFPA 70E practices
  • Proficiency in using CMMS
  • Physical ability to stand, lift, and carry up to 50 lbs
  • Ability to work in challenging conditions (noise, dust, chemicals, temperature extremes) while wearing full PPE

Preferred Qualifications

  • Associates degree, Trade School, or Military technical background
  • Experience with heavy commercial equipment, conveyors, pump rebuilds, rigging, and machine installations
